Abstract (Croatian)

U ovom radu obrađene su osnove elektroplinskog zavarivanja, varijante postupka te oprema, parametri, elektrode i zaštitni plinovi koji se koriste. Detaljno je opisana klasifikacija elektroda za EPZ. Razmotrene su promjene strukture metala zavara i ZUT-a zbog visokih unosa topline te njihov utjecaj na mehanička svojstva. Na kraju teorijskog dijela su opisani problemi kod zavarivanja te karakteristične greške i njihovi uzroci. Eksperimentalni dio se sastojao od zavarivanja ploča čelika S235JR sa žicom za zavarivanje G3Si1 u zaštiti 100% CO2 i 82% Ar/18% CO2 te ispitivanja koja su se sastojala od vizualne kontrole, makroanalize, mjerenja tvrdoće i ispitivanja udarne radnje loma. Na kraju je dan operativni okvir parametara zavarivanja za konstrukcijski čelik debljine 10 mm.

Abstract

This paper covers basics of electrogas welding along with variations of process, equipment, process variables, electrodes and shielding gases used. Specification for electrodes for EGW is described in detail. Due to high heat input, changes in metal weld structure and in heat affected zone are discussed, as well as their effect on mechanical properties. The first part of this paper also deals with problems encountered in electrogas welding and with typical geometric imperfections and their causes. The experimental part consisted of S235JR structural steel plates welding with G3Si1 solid wire and in 100% CO2 and 82% Ar/18% CO2 shielding atmosphere and inspections that consisted of visual inspection, microscopic examination of welds, measurement of hardness and impact test. At the end of this paper there is the operational framework of the welding variables for structural steel of thickness 10 mm.
